Job Summary

The City of Dallas is seeking a Recreation Center Assistant to support the development, planning, and implementation of recreational, cultural, and educational programs at the city's recreation centers. This role will assist recreation program staff in coordinating logistics and participating in youth services, senior assistance, recreation programs, special events, and other services.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in developing and implementing programs and activities at small or large recreation centers.
  • Lead recreational activities, demonstrate sports procedures and techniques, and instruct participants in the rules of various games.
  • Assist with after-school programs, providing organized recreational activities and educational assistance.
  • Compile and maintain records, including attendance reports and revenue generated.
  • Provide information to participants and the public regarding recreation center functions and programs.
  • Perform various administrative tasks, including processing registrations, disbursing schedules, and answering phones.
  • Transport youth to field trips and special events.
  • Instruct participants and enforce rules, regulations, and safety precautions.
  • Provide outreach, marketing, and distribution of program materials.
Requirements
  • Knowledge of recreation facilities and general programming.
  • Ability to work with children, youth, and adults.
  • Knowledge of sports and general rules.
  • Knowledge of first aid principles and practices.
  • Ability to develop activities and work with a multi-cultural community.
  • Ability to enforce recreation, program, and sporting regulations.
  • Establishing and maintaining effective relationships.
  • Knowledge of strong customer service principles and practices.
  • Communicating effectively orally and in writing.
Working Conditions

This is a full-time position that requires a valid Texas Driver's License and First Aid/CPR certification within 6 months of employment. The City of Dallas is an Equal Opportunity Employer and values diversity at all levels of its workforce.
